Event Opal Bi-Amplified Nearfield Monitor, 750W Peak Power, Elliptical Rotating Waveguide, The Event Opal Bi-Amplified Nearfield Monitor brings true-to-life sound reproduction in a compact black powder-coated aluminum chassis. The Opal is built to help promote pure sound with its injected molded aluminum chassis. The Opal's special design diminishes standing waves with two variable impedance ports for the low frequencies and an elliptical rotating wave guide ideal for use horizontally. The low frequency EX8 X-Coil transducer made from polyamide-glass fiber is powered by up to 600W of Class AB power while the 1 Neodymium HF transducer has a Beryllium copper dome powered by up to 140W of Class AB power as well.
